Hindhead is a small historic village on the edge of the South Downs, situated between the larger towns of Farnham and Haslemere both having good high street shopping and main line rail connections to London, Haslemere being the closest. Access to the A3 is easy, with motorway style connections to London, the South Coast and both principal airports. Hindhead benefits from many acres of protected countryside, owned by the National Trust, the Devil’s Punchbowl (being one) which is a designated area of outstanding natural beauty.
Close by, there are several Golf Courses, including Hindhead Golf Course which was founded in 1904 by Sir Arthur Conan Doyle
The well established and highly regarded private school Amesbury is within walking distance, while Grayshott Village centre is within a 20 minute walk which offers a wealth of individual shops and services which include; Post Office, village pub, social club, restaurants, cafes & takeaways, 2 small supermarkets, butcher, greengrocer, ironmonger, chemist, doctors, dentists, sports field with pavilion and tennis club.
